Regulatory Landscape: Navigating the Legal Framework
Over the past decade, Canadian provinces have taken varied approaches towards regulating online gambling. Notably, Ontario’s recent move to establish a comprehensive, regulated online gaming market has set a precedent, bringing the industry under rigorous oversight since January 2022. According to the Ontario Alcohol and Gaming Commission (AGCO), the regulated market has generated over CAD 1.1 billion in revenue during its first year, illustrating the sector’s lucrative potential.
However, disparities remain across provinces, with some areas still relying on grey-market operators. This patchwork regulatory environment prompts both challenges and opportunities. Licensed operators that adhere to strict standards are gaining consumer trust, especially when they implement responsible gambling measures and data security protocols.
Technological Innovation: Elevating Player Engagement
The adoption of cutting-edge technologies is redefining online casino offerings in Canada.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) facilitate personalized experiences, improving user engagement and retention. Live dealer games, powered by real-time streaming technology, bridge the gap between digital and land-based experiences, fostering greater immersion and trust.
Moreover, the integration of cryptocurrencies and blockchain provides transparency and security for transactions, catering to a growing demographic of tech-savvy players. For example, some platforms now offer optional Bitcoin deposits and withdrawals, reflecting global trends towards decentralization in online payments.
Player Experience: From Accessibility to Responsible Gaming
Enhancing the user experience remains at the core of successful online casino operation. Platforms aim for seamless navigation, high-quality graphics, and variety in gaming options—from slots and poker to sports betting. The mobile-first approach ensures players can enjoy gaming on the go, with instant access via dedicated apps or mobile-optimized websites.
“Today’s players demand more than just a game; they seek an engaging, secure, and responsible environment. Operators who can deliver on these fronts will thrive in Canada’s competitive market.”
Responsible gambling initiatives are increasingly integrated into platforms, with tools for setting de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and real-time support. Industry leaders understand that trust and safety are fundamental to long-term growth.
Market Data and Industry Insights
Recent surveys indicate that approximately 65% of Canadian online gamblers are aged between 25 and 45, emphasizing a young, tech-enabled demographic. Revenue projections suggest the sector will grow at an annual rate of about 15% over the next five years, driven by provincial regulation, technological advances, and shifting consumer attitudes.
